diff options
author | Linux Build Service Account <lnxbuild@localhost> | 2019-06-14 18:48:31 -0700 |
---|---|---|
committer | Linux Build Service Account <lnxbuild@localhost> | 2019-06-14 18:48:31 -0700 |
commit | 2625e7083ff118e8da856eb1dd04d39d2a527e22 (patch) | |
tree | 72b04289561812bf1a52d5c14cfa2e6986cd76e1 /core/SystemStatus.cpp | |
parent | 2d333ab2d898e1119576b2507fa5f1e95b90d124 (diff) | |
parent | 3bbb89aee1a89cc7d268927ac8265a70a330f2fb (diff) | |
download | gps-2625e7083ff118e8da856eb1dd04d39d2a527e22.tar.gz |
Merge 3bbb89aee1a89cc7d268927ac8265a70a330f2fb on remote branch
Change-Id: I8ce184682331aed809cdf4e36611ccd7b84c02e3
Diffstat (limited to 'core/SystemStatus.cpp')
-rw-r--r-- | core/SystemStatus.cpp |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/core/SystemStatus.cpp b/core/SystemStatus.cpp index 18cb99c..9ca126f 100644 --- a/core/SystemStatus.cpp +++ b/core/SystemStatus.cpp @@ -1723,5 +1723,18 @@ bool SystemStatus::eventConnectionStatus(bool connected, int8_t type, return true; } +/****************************************************************************** +@brief API to update power connect state + +@param[In] power connect status + +@return true when successfully done +******************************************************************************/ +bool SystemStatus::updatePowerConnectState(bool charging) +{ + SystemStatusPowerConnectState s(charging); + mSysStatusObsvr.notify({&s}); + return true; +} } // namespace loc_core |